Man, I love this show. If you haven't seen it, it's on VH1 and the basic premise is that each episode attempt to locate and reunite the original members of old, defunct rock groups. Most of them are one hit wonder types from the early 80's like Haircut 100 or Flock of Seagulls. It's sort of like Behind The Music meets Candid Camera.
They give a little background on the band and then the host and a crew go out and more or less stalk the members imdividually and try to get them to agree to hold a one time reunion show. Assuming the members agree, they then bring them together in a rehearsal studio for group hugs and the occasional sharp comments - sometimes members were forced out or left under unhappy circumstances and sometimes they haven't seen each other in years. Next is a frequently amusing segment as the bands try to remember how their songs actually went. The end of the succesful episodes feature a couple songs from the reunion concert which have usually sounded pretty good considering.
It's kind of cool because you never really know if it'll pull together or not. Some bands get nowhere near the rehearsal studio stage, like Extreme (the guitarist turned it down cold) and New Kids on the Block. If an episode is only slotted for half an hour, it's a bad sign. Last night's episode featured ABC and two of the four members who gave "maybes" never showed up for the rehearsal stage (they held the concert anyway with studio musicians filling in.)
